Meet the 2021 All-Tidewater boys soccer first and second teams

First Colonial's Owen Ruddy, right, attempts a bicycle kick around John R. Lewis' Oliver Turcos during the Class 5 state final June 23. The Patriots took their first state championship with the victory.

All-Tidewater Player of the Year

Owen Ruddy

First Colonial, senior midfielder

  • Led the Patriots (14-0-1) to the program’s first Class 5 state championship
  • Had 15 goals and seven assists
  • “Exceptional leader, playmaker and was one of the heartbeats of the team.” — coach Juice Pantophlet

First team

Carsten Bay

Cox, senior defender

Cox's Carsten Bay plays defense as he moves in on the ball against First Colonial on May 7, 2021 in Virginia Beach.
  • Helped lead the Falcons (11-2) to the Class 5 Region A title game
  • Served as a team captain
  • Anchored a Falcons back line that recorded eight shutouts
  • Signed with Virginia Tech

Josh Condit

Smithfield, senior defender

Smithfield senior defender Josh Condit, 2021.
  • Helped lead the Packers (15-0) to a perfect season and Class 4 state championship
  • Had three goals and seven assists
  • “The team only conceded five goals all year and he was the main reason that was possible.” — coach Jason Henderson

Matt Fitzer

Menchville, senior forward

Menchville’s Matt Fitzer, right, scores a goal on a penalty kick to tie the game at 1 during Tuesday’s game at Kecoughtan in Hampton. Mike Caudill/Freelance (June 1, 2021)
  • Led the Monarchs (11-1-1) to the Class 4 Region A title game
  • Tallied 31 goals and six assists

Garrett Hodges

First Colonial, junior goalkeeper

First Colonial goalkeeper Garrett Hodges blocks a penalty kick from Cox defender Carsten Bay during the Class 5 Region A boys soccer final at Powhatan Field in Norfolk on June 18, 2021. First Colonial won the game in penalty kicks.
  • Backstopped the Patriots (14-0-1) to the program’s first Class 5 state championship
  • Recorded 11 shutouts and three goals against
  • Kept First Colonial’s season alive with two saves in penalty kicks in the region final against Cox

Cooper Kieran

Kellam, senior midfielder

Kellam senior midfielder Cooper Kieran, 2021.
  • Led the Knights (9-3) to the Class 6 Region A semifinals
  • Had two goals and four assists as a defensive midfielder
  • “Controls the game with precise passing and excellent first touch.” — coach Craig Powers
  • Signed with Kentucky

Blake Lowery

Lafayette, senior forward

Lafayette senior forward Blake Lowery, 2021.
  • Led the Rams (10-3) to the Class 3 Region A final
  • Had 15 goals and six assists playing as a forward and midfielder

Sam Martin

Cox, senior midfielder

Cox senior midfielder Sam Martin, 2021.
  • Helped lead the Falcons (11-2-0) to the Class 5 Region A title game
  • Had 10 goals and 18 assists
  • Team captain who controlled the midfield as an elite distributor

Liam Moore

Smithfield, senior midfielder

Smithfield senior midfielder Liam Moore, 2021
  • Helped lead the Packers (15-0) to a perfect season and Class 4 state championship
  • Had eight goals and 14 assists
  • “Liam was involved in more than half of our goals, whether it would be an assist or a goal.” - coach Jason Henderson

Michael Nopper

First Colonial, senior defender

First Colonial senior defender Michael Nopper, 2021.
  • Anchored FC’s back line to help win the program’s first Class 5 state championship
  • Scored three goals
  • “His leadership and work ethic set the standard for the rest of the team.” - coach Juice Pantophlet

Gavin Page

Hickory, junior forward

Hickory junior forward Gavin Page, 2021.
  • Led the Hawks (6-2-2) to the Class 5 Region A quarterfinals
  • Had 12 goals and six assists
  • “Dynamic forward who causes every team problems.” - coach Mike Gyori

Colin Skwirut

Kecoughtan, sophomore midfielder

Kecoughtan sophomore midfielder Colin Skwirut, 2021.
  • Led the Warriors (10-1-1) to the Class 5 Region A semifinals
  • Had six goals and seven assists as a defensive midfielder
  • “Outstanding technical and tactical player.” — coach Scott Canaday
